const rsort = require('route-sort');
const NAME = 'webpack-route-manifest';
function toAsset(str) {
if (/\.js$/i.test(str)) return 'script';
if (/\.(svg|jpe?g|png|webp)$/i.test(str)) return 'image';
if (/\.(woff2?|otf|ttf|eot)$/i.test(str)) return 'font';
if (/\.css$/i.test(str)) return 'style';
return false;
}
function toLink(assets, _pattern, _filemap) {
let value = '';
assets.forEach(obj => {
if (value) value += ', ';
value += `<${obj.href}>; rel=preload; as=${obj.type}`;
if (/^(font|script)$/.test(obj.type)) value += '; crossorigin=anonymous';
});
return [{ key: 'Link', value }];
}
function toFunction(val) {
if (typeof val === 'function') return val;
if (typeof val === 'object') return key => val[key];
}
class RouteManifest {
constructor(opts={}) {
const { routes, assets, headers, minify } = opts;
const { filename='manifest.json', sort=true, inline=true } = opts;
if (!routes) {
throw new Error('A "routes" mapping is required');
}
const toRoute = toFunction(routes);
const toHeaders = toFunction(headers) || headers === true && toLink;
const toType = toFunction(assets) || toAsset;
this.run = bundle => {
const Pages = new Map();
const Manifest = {};
const Files = {};
const { publicPath, chunks, modules } = bundle.getStats().toJson();
// Map pages to files
chunks.forEach(chunk => {
const { id, files, origins, entry } = chunk;
const origin = origins[0].request;
const route = origin && !entry ? toRoute(origin) : '*';
if (route) {
Pages.set(id, {
assets: new Set(files),
pattern: route
});
}
});
// Grab extra files per route
modules.forEach(mod => {
mod.assets.forEach(asset => {
mod.chunks.forEach(id => {
const tmp = Pages.get(id);
if (tmp) {
tmp.assets.add(asset);
Pages.set(id, tmp);
}
});
});
});
// Construct `Files` first
Pages.forEach(obj => {
let tmp = Files[obj.pattern] = Files[obj.pattern] || [];
// Iterate, possibly filtering out
// TODO: Add priority hints?
obj.assets.forEach(str => {
let type = toType(str);
let href = publicPath + str;
if (type) tmp.push({ type, href });
});
});
function write(data) {
// Get the 1st script that's globally shared
const asset = Files['*'].find(x => x.type === 'script');
const script = asset && asset.href && asset.href.replace(publicPath, '');
if (inline && script && bundle.assets[script]) {
let nxt = `window.__rmanifest=${JSON.stringify(data)};`;
nxt += bundle.assets[script].source();
// TODO: Does NOT invalidate hash
// ~> bcuz too late in the chain
bundle.assets[script] = {
size: () => nxt.length,
source: () => nxt
};
}
const str = JSON.stringify(data, null, minify ? 0 : 2);
bundle.assets[filename] = {
size: () => str.length,
source: () => str
};
}
// All patterns
const routes = Object.keys(Files);
if (sort) rsort(routes);
// No headers? Then stop here
if (!toHeaders) {
if (!sort) return write(Files); // order didn't matter
return write(routes.reduce((o, key) => (o[key]=Files[key], o), {}));
}
// Otherwise compute "headers" per pattern
// And save existing Files as "files" key
routes.forEach(pattern => {
const files = Files[pattern];
const headers = toHeaders(files, pattern, Files) || [];
Manifest[pattern] = { files, headers };
});
return write(Manifest);
};
}
apply(compiler) {
if (compiler.hooks !== void 0) {
compiler.hooks.emit.tap(NAME, this.run);
} else {
compiler.plugin('emit', this.run);
}
}
}
module.exports = RouteManifest;
